How did the first Americans travel here from Asia?
The first Americans traveled here from Asia by walking across a land bridge that connected Asia and North America during the Ice Age. The first Americans were hunters, and they were following migrating animals.
How did the Native Americans in the Desert Southwest ADAPT to their environment?
The Native Americans in the Desert Southwest adapted to their environment by building houses of adobe instead of trees. They learned to farm in the desert and found crops that would grow in the desert environment.
How did the Native Americans in the Pacific Northwest ADAPT to their environment?
The Native Americans in the Pacific Northwest adapted to their environment by making things out of wood. They depended on the fish, wildlife, and plants instead of farming. They built their villages on the narrow coastline where the land was flat.

Describe trading among the Eastern Woodland Indians.
People in the Great Lakes region used the lakes and waterways of the area as trade routes. People like the Odawa developed as great traders, moving goods between other groups. Traders looked for goods that could not be found or made from the resources in their area. For example, people in good farming area traded crops for meat and furs offered by skilled hunters in other areas. Traders from areas with birch trees traded birchbark containers for things made of copper which was not available in their area.
Describe Haudenosaunee life.
Clans were an important part of their life. Men and women had different roles, but both were important. Women had power within the village, and houses and property were shared.
Describe how the Plains Indians used their main resource, the buffalo.
The Plains Indians used the buffalo in many ways. They ate the buffalo meat, carved the bones into tools, and wove hair into rope. They used the buffalo skin for covers for their shelters, blankets, and clothing.
